Transaction 588055f910e2bf264c30359e9c570da1ebc558e7831343c4716a5bac9cce132f
1 Input
1 Output
-
588055f910e2bf264c30359e9c570da1ebc558e7831343c4716a5bac9cce132f:0
- value
- 2136498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 001a6cb930cb745e66c999b4661597812e9c629c OP_EQUAL
- address
- 31hZaZg4Ttqq9KktDWfzZvn1ERRiHTHsfV